Replacing the optical drive

Attention: Do not open your computer or attempt any repair before reading and understanding the "Read
this first: Important safety information" on page iii.
To replace the optical drive, do the following:
1. Remove any media from the drives and turn off all connected devices and the computer. Then,
disconnect all power cords from electrical outlets and disconnect all cables that are connected to the
computer.
2. Remove the computer cover. See "Removing the computer cover" on page 52.
3. Remove the front bezel. See "Replacing the front bezel" on page 52.
4. Locate the optical drive. See "Computer components" on page 4.
5. Disconnect the signal cable and the power cable from the rear of the optical drive. See "Parts on
the system board" on page 5.
6. Press the blue release button and slide the optical drive to the front of the computer.
